__________________can be extended to systems which are time-varying ?
Correct answer: D. State model representatives
- A. Bode-Nyquist stability methods
- B. Transfer functions
- C. Root locus design
- D. State model representatives
Explanation
State-space models use state equations that can include time-dependent coefficients, so they apply to time-varying systems. Transfer functions and root-locus methods are primarily formulated for linear time-invariant systems.
